Default Help please!!! 3.8 to 4.6 swap

I recently bought a 94 v6 5speed for cheap and also aquired a 4.6L engine ECM and harnesses for cheap. So i began the swap, i have the 4.6 in with the new k-member and still need a trans flywheel clutch driveshaft and a few other upgrades to the v6 drivetrain. I was most likely gonna try to pick up a T-45 and bolt that up, but money is tight. I have a 5.0 stang that i put a new t-5 aluminum flywheel and clutch that has been sitting for a while. does anyone know if there is an aftermarket bellhousing out there that i could use my 157 tooth t-5, flywheel and clutch with my 4.6??? Any info would be greatly appreciated, also any help with ECM flashing, or anyone who might have done this swap before. Thanks, Jack
